So I was wondering if it is at all possible to use different textures on both sides of a mesh? Think of a cube that has a texture on the outside faces and another texture on the inside of the cube. So I was wondering if it is at all possible to use different textures on both sides of a mesh?
Use a Geometry node to control different materials on front and back faces. http://wiki.blender.org/index.php/Doc:2.6/Manual/Render/Cycles/Nodes/More#Geometry
